This 2-pack of 3/8''x4' grounding rods is designed for effective grounding of electrical systems, including antennas and satellite dishes. Made from copper-plated steel, these rods ensure optimal lightning protection and performance. Each pack includes a pre-installed screw wire clamp for easy setup, and the rods are built to endure various environmental conditions. Earth grounding made easy.
This worked perfectly to ground a small off grid solar setup in a barn. The 2000 watt inverter chassis needed to have a ground, and this did the trick. I used a sledge hammer to drive it in and the soil was moist enough to make it pretty easy.Satisfying.

Great when you need a good ground system.
Easy installation just make sure that the ground is not frozen or totally dry, this makes installation a real job, we had snow on the ground for a month and then when the snow finally melted it went into the ground very easily. Nice to have a good ground on a Ham Radio station, this did it.

A little bent
OK, no big deal, but it didn't arrive in the greatest of shape. First, it was wrapped in tough plastic that was very difficult to remove. It had a patch of orange flakey gluey stuff near the bottom; I have no idea what it was, but had to be cleaned off with some effort. Finally, the rod was bent about 15 degrees towards the bottom.But I did get it unwrapped, and I was able to clean off the gluey stuff with Mostenbocker's Lift Off, and bending the rod back to approximate straightness with a foot and my hands was not difficult. Besides, the bent part will be underground anyway.The rod's diameter is 10mm or about 3/8" so one should take care pounding it into the ground as not to bend it. I would not recommend this ground rod for a situation where it carried any current on an ongoing basis because that could cause the plating to fail. I use mine for a shortwave radio ground.
